Output 75213de80c299008868f73ea530e052936b64141081e3bb08cea53e0681b7e16:1

value
1007457
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f51705c4bd68c0307d76faa10087d68f45f59ef OP_EQUALVERIFY OP_CHECKSIG
address
18EPwdVUQojWrAJP3iN8bYrELJCPD8W3zA
transaction
75213de80c299008868f73ea530e052936b64141081e3bb08cea53e0681b7e16
spent
true